In a move that signals the beginning of a new era for the New York Mets, the team has officially named Francisco Lindor as their captain. This announcement is not just a ceremonial gesture, but a declaration of the direction the franchise intends to take in the coming years. Lindor, widely regarded as one of the most talented and charismatic shortstops in Major League Baseball, is stepping into this significant role, bringing with him a blend of leadership, skill, and a commitment to winning that has the potential to elevate the Mets both on and off the field.
A Leader in the Making
Francisco Lindor’s journey to becoming the Mets’ captain began long before the official title was bestowed upon him. Even in his early days with the Cleveland Indians, Lindor was recognized for his leadership abilities. His combination of on-field performance and off-field character made him a natural leader, and it was no surprise when he was named an All-Star multiple times and earned a reputation as one of the league’s most respected figures.
When Lindor was traded to the Mets in the 2021 offseason, there was immediate buzz about his impact on the team. His infectious energy, passion for the game, and ability to perform in the clutch quickly endeared him to fans and teammates alike. By the time the 2022 season came around, it was clear that Lindor had already become one of the central figures in the Mets’ clubhouse.
The title of captain, however, is about more than just being a great player. It’s about guiding a team through adversity, representing the franchise with integrity, and fostering a winning culture. Lindor’s work ethic, humility, and dedication to his teammates made him an obvious choice for the Mets’ front office, signaling a shift toward a more united, determined, and resilient team culture.
